Had my driver fitting at Ping today and of course it wasn't a great day with the swing, it wasn't a bad technical day apparently my path and strike location was good I just couldn't get the hands to not shut at impact. 

 

Anyways that very hooky shot shape was extremely prevalent today just fighting it, the fitter tried multiple settings and weights. Apparently the weight in my G430 LST is only 22g and he suggested 25g or 28g so just going to play with some lead tape. I was also low on the face all day long so he bumped the loft up and tinkered a bit more put the adapter into F+ which turns it flat and adds 1° of loft to bring the head to 10° of loft vs the 8° that I had. So I have some guidance for my driver and a bit more tinkering to do myself. 

 

Onto the G440 LST after a ton of swings, was just given a 10.5° head, Tour Black 60X shaft and I forget the settings but almost instantly it was better, hands were still shut a bit but I wasn't feeling the head close at impact. Lead to some better drives, a few really nice ones but I instantly noticed/asked if the Tour Black shaft is much stiffer in the tip and he said overall it's pretty stout. Obviously a black profile but similar to Ventus Black. We tested the Tensei 1k Black but found that to be a bit softer and not as tight and then he whipped out the Ventus TR Black in 7X which is an 80g shaft, felt nice but was kinda heavy and I was pushing a ton of swing. 

 

We then just had to confirm and tossed the Tour Black shaft into my G430 LST, took a few swings and it felt better with the stiffer tip so the fitter suggested for now try and find a Tour Black shaft he suggested I order the Tour Black 75 meant for fairways but just toss it into my driver, also play it at 46" over the 45.5" at impact was much better. 

 

So the gameplan for the driver is...I'm going to hunt for a Tour Black shaft, more likely to find a 60X since a 75X will be fairway length used. I'll also keep an eye out locally for maybe a Ventus TR Black 6X or TR Blue 6X/TX, maybe Velo+ Black 7X or maybe see what my buddy has laying around from Accra, I'm sure the RPG Tour I tested a while back could work here or the Shogun Red maybe will see what I can get a deal on. There are a ton of stout tip stiff shafts out there.

 

As for the G440 LST head, well I really like that head but I don't think it's a must buy at the moment I'll keep an eye out for a used head or driver setup but will stick with the G430 LST right now, definitely need to change the shafts up, the TPT I might sell after testing but that could fund the G440 or maybe offset a new shaft or something.

Had my iron fitting earlier so incoming new wall of text. 

 

As many of you know I've been working on my swing and body a ton, I got these irons kinda at the start of my changes and lately I've been feeling something is off with them, most likely not setup well for me. So I book 2 hours with a new studio in town with raving reviews of skilled fitters and here is what we went through. 

 

I went in looking at going through the Avoda irons fitting cause it is honestly interesting, a lot like Foreward golf they really focus on the length, lie, shaft, grip, weight, etc. I know many will say "oh like any other fitting" no not quite, go watch a video on their fittings.

 

So we start, get a small baseline with my gear which off the top of my head is: 

 

Length: +1/2" they measure +1/4"

Lie: Up 2°

Shaft: DG 120 X100

Grip: MCC+4 Mid w/wraps 

 

Started with length and instantly noticed that "standard" suits me much better, I'm able to get down on the ball and strike it better, first thing down. 

 

Next lie, the Avoda heads come in a few lies and for me we found the flatter head was better I think it was marked 62° for a 6i. I definitely didn't get the massive occasional hooks like on my current irons since my path is much more neutral now. 

 

Grips, in tested Avoda uses the JumboMax Grips, we tested the Standard Oversize, XS and Medium. The Medium i flipped my hands too much just smother a ton, XS wasn't bad would need more time with them and the Oversize was best. When I told them my grip setup they said just stick with what I got for now. 

 

Shaft, this was interesting for me we tested a few and found out my current irons the handle is too soft so I lose a bit of control. I guess we've gotten plenty strong and need a pretty stout but smooth profile. We actually landed kinda at the KBS C-Taper 120S or 130X but feel the 120S I can swing smoother and more consistent. But this we'll retest. 

 

By this point we're 80-90 swings in and have an idea of where we are at. The fitter then asks if I wanted to test any brands I gave said I'm open to whoever he thought would work for me, he then pulled the Ping Blueprint S as I mentioned I'm Ping fan earlier in my fitting towards other gear. First 3 swings he said "this probably beats the Avoda" and i felt the same the BPS with the setup from the avoda fitting was really nice. 

 

Then the fitter asks me my thoughts on Cobra irons i say "I think they're underrated and wouldn't mind hitting one" he says perfect and pulls the King Tour for me, i kinda wanted the CB but that's a small head and the Tour is obviously played on tour. First 3 strikes were all pretty big over draws fitter says "don't get discouraged, path is good hands are shut let me throw a bigger grip on that and take a breather and a drink". He then comes back after a few minutes with a midsized grip on and we start swinging again and after 2 so-so swings he mentioned "oh yeah this is the CT 130X, don't have a 120S for Cobra" so a hair more patience and then I start going off with these 1-3 yard draws just dead center, ball speed jumps, impact is crip, this is the club so far and the fitter was just enjoying it. I mentioned it feels so good and I can just cruise and swing easy and he jokes "your easy is 3mph faster than PGA tour". 

 

He then wants to go the complete opposite and grabs a Srixon ZX7 which i played the 585/785 way back and this was 3 and done, didn't like something about them just strikes were off and didn't want to waste anymore swings at this point. 

 

We were speaking about various things like combo sets and blending then says ok just hit a few with the T150 since they blend easy. I did, very solid, similar to the BPS maybe a touch firmer but definitely an option. 

 

After 150 swings I was cooked but we had it narrowed down to this setup: 

 

Length: Standard 

Lie: Standard (Cobra/Titleist), 1Flat (Ping)

Grip: MCC+4 Mid w/Wraps 

Shaft: KBS C-Taper 120S or 130X

 

So what won? We don't know it's narrowed down to the Cobra King Tour, Ping Blueprint S, Titleist T150 and Avoda. We'll be back to test a few more things but they said next time they'll take 20-30min just test those 4 heads when I'm fresh to get a winner and give me time to research them a bit. 

 

Honestly looking at them all the Cobra are probably winning as shafts are stock and grips a small up charge. The Avoda are a bit more then the Ping and Titleist are 1k more than the Cobra and I was told the Titleist are possibly subject to tariffs so even more. Honestly as much as I love the Pings the extra 1K I can outfit myself with the new woods I wanted. But who knows, swing and wallet said Cobra, fanboy says Ping, eyes thought all were good to look at.

Finished up the iron fit today and a bit of top of bag fit as well. My swing the past 2 weeks hasn't been great, my biceps tendinitis has flared up so swing consistency is off, but this is something I'd have to deal with during the season so not a big deal and shows me on a bad day. 

 

So to people who complain about not being 100% during a fitting how often are we golfing at 100% as well? 

 

Anyway the final 2 as mentioned were the Ping Blueprint S and Cobra King Tours. I did the best i could, my path was solid but just couldn't keep the face in control so saw a lot of misses but took the positive from it and basically saw what had the best misses to minimize damage on the course. 

 

The best shaft from the first fitting was the KBS C-Taper 120 these are listed as a "stiff" but they're quite stout. We did tinker with the C-Taper 130 but just too heavy i had to go all out, also tried a PX6.0 or 6.5, a DGX100 and a KBS Tour. Most would work but the C-Taper i just timed up so well and could both step on it or coast. 

 

Both irons performed well and again could play either no problem but there was a stand out in the data deep dive. The distance was more consistent, the spin was in a better delta, height was a bit lower (still like 130) and the misses were mostly a safe push cut where the other saw more of a pull hook. The biggest difference was the sound on well struck shots they were just so much crisper. 

 

That's why the irons going into my bag will be the.....Cobra King Tours.
